Grant Morrison Almost Came Close To Creating The DarkestSpider-ManStory

Grant Morrisonis one of the most renowned talents who has contributed his skills and creativity to the DC comics as he has worked in the comics featuring the popular DC superheroes, Superman and Batman. However, Morrison had once come immensely close to working with Marvel that too for Spider-Man. The story would not have followed a typical storyline featuring Peter Parker as the Web-Slinger, as Morrison wanted Parker to walk down a darker path similar to DC Watchmen’s Rorschach.

Grant Morrison’sSpider-ManComic Paid Tribute To The Legendary Comic Artist, Steve Ditko

“The weedy Ditko Spidey’s in a position to take the Romita Peter’s place and have a taste of everything he ever wanted.”

Morrison added,

“In some alternate Marvel universe, Romita never came on board, Stan gave Ditko free reign and Objectivist ideas were increasingly given dramatic form in mid-’60s Spider-Man stories!”

Morrison wanted to explore Ditko’s Objectivist views, which later became the main reason to provide inspiration to DC’s Rorschach in Watchmen. The artist claims the story would have ended with the Ditko Spider-Man having “the potential to turn into Rorschach!” Though the proposed idea was intriguing, it is heartbreaking to learn that the comic book would never be released.
